Amu the African (Children’s Edition) brings to life the story of Dr. Ephraim Amu, one of Ghana’s most celebrated educationists and cultural reformers, in a format tailored for young readers. Adapted from the acclaimed biography Amu the African: A Study in Vision and Courage, this edition, authored by Fred M. Agyemang and Phanuel Nyaku, presents a simplified narrative that instills timeless values in children.
Through this beautifully retold story, children are introduced to Amu’s selflessness, originality, deep respect for African heritage, and unwavering commitment to education and reform. The book encourages Ghanaian youth to walk in the footsteps of Dr. Amu, whose life impacted generations of pupils and students across five decades.

✍️ About the Authors


Fred M. Agyemang
Fred Agyemang is a seasoned Ghanaian journalist and former Director of the Ghana Institute of Journalism. He is a respected author and biographer, credited with six major publications that explore leadership, culture, and national development.
Lt. Col. Phanuel Nyaku (Rtd.)
Phanuel Nyaku is a retired military officer, former Director of Education for the Ghana Armed Forces, and Personnel Manager at Fanmilk Ltd. A French scholar, translator, and member of the Ghana Association of Writers, he brings linguistic and cultural expertise to children’s literature and African storytelling.
